Why C4 Corvette Wiring Diagrams Are Essential
When dealing with any vehicle's electrical system, having a wiring diagram is like having a
roadmap. The C4 Corvette features a complex network of wiring that controls everything
from the engine management system to interior lighting and safety features. Without a
reliable wiring diagram, pinpointing issues such as blown fuses, malfunctioning gauges, or
faulty sensors becomes a frustrating guessing game.
Wiring diagrams provide a detailed illustration of the electrical circuits, showing wire
colors, connectors, grounds, and power sources. For the C4 Corvette, these diagrams are
especially important because of the car’s advanced electronics for its time, including the
onboard computer systems and digital dashboards found in later models.

How to Read and Use C4 Corvette Wiring Diagrams Effectively
Once you have access to a wiring diagram, understanding how to interpret it is crucial.
Wiring diagrams are not always intuitive, especially for beginners, but with some practice,
they become powerful tools.
Key Components of Wiring Diagrams
A typical wiring diagram includes:
Wire colors and codes: Each wire is color-coded and may have abbreviations
1.
indicating its function (e.g., BLK for black, RED for red).
Connectors and terminals: Symbols represent connectors, plugs, or splices
2.
where wires join or separate.
Ground points: Indicated by the ground symbol, these are crucial for completing
3.
circuits.
Power sources: Battery connections and fuse boxes are shown to trace where
4.
power originates.
Component symbols: Icons denote switches, sensors, relays, and actuators in the
5.
system.
Tips for Tracing Circuits
Start with the problem area: Identify the system or component that’s
1.
malfunctioning, then follow its wiring path on the diagram.
Check power and ground first: Many electrical issues stem from a lack of power
2.
or a poor ground connection.
Use a multimeter: Measuring voltage, continuity, and resistance along the wires
3.
can confirm what the diagram shows.
Mark your progress: When working with printed diagrams, highlighting or making
4.
notes helps avoid confusion.
Common Electrical Issues and Troubleshooting with Wiring
Diagrams
The C4 Corvette, like many classic cars, can experience various electrical problems that
frustrate owners. Wiring diagrams are instrumental in diagnosing these issues efficiently.
Starter and Ignition Problems
If your C4 Corvette doesn’t start or experiences intermittent starting failures, wiring
diagrams help trace the ignition switch, starter relay, and solenoid circuits. Checking
these against the diagram can reveal broken wires, loose connections, or faulty relays.
Lighting and Signal Malfunctions
Problems with headlights, brake lights, or turn signals are common and often due to
wiring faults or bad grounds. Using the wiring diagram, you can verify the correct wire
colors and trace the circuit back to fuses or switches.
Dashboard Instrument Cluster Issues
The digital and analog gauges in the C4 rely on proper wiring for accurate readings. If
gauges behave erratically or warning lights stay on, the diagrams allow you to check
sensor wiring, ground connections, and signal inputs.

Maintaining the Electrical Health of Your C4 Corvette
Regular maintenance and inspection of your C4 Corvette’s wiring can prevent many
common issues. Using wiring diagrams to guide your checks helps ensure all connections
are secure and corrosion-free.
Visual Inspections and Cleaning
Look for cracked insulation, loose connectors, and corrosion at terminals. Referencing
wiring diagrams can help you identify critical areas to inspect, such as fuse panels or key
connectors near the engine bay.
Fuse and Relay Checks
Wiring diagrams show fuse locations and ratings, enabling you to quickly identify and
replace blown fuses or faulty relays that could cause circuit failures.
Protecting Against Environmental Damage
The C4 Corvette’s wiring is exposed to heat and moisture, which can degrade wires over
time. Use wiring diagrams to locate vulnerable wiring harnesses and consider protective
measures like heat-resistant sleeves or dielectric grease on connectors.

Evolution of Wiring Systems Across the C4 Corvette Generations
Throughout its 13-year production run, the C4 Corvette underwent several electrical
system upgrades. Early models from the mid-1980s featured relatively straightforward
wiring harnesses, focusing on analog gauges and basic electronic controls. By the early
1990s, more advanced modules, such as the Engine Control Module (ECM) and
Transmission Control Module (TCM), introduced additional layers of complexity.
For instance, the 1992 C4 Corvette was the first to incorporate a new digital dashboard
and an updated fuel injection system, leading to distinct wiring layouts compared to
earlier models. Consequently, wiring diagrams must be matched precisely with the
vehicle’s model year and trim level to ensure compatibility.

Comparing C4 Corvette Wiring Diagrams to Other Corvette
Generations
When contrasted with earlier (C3) or later (C5 and beyond) Corvette wiring diagrams, the
C4’s schematics reflect a transitional phase in automotive electronics. The C3 wiring
harnesses were simpler, predominantly analog, and easier to interpret for those
accustomed to classic car wiring. Conversely, the C5 introduced more integrated
electronics and multiplexed wiring, raising the complexity level.
The C4's wiring diagrams strike a balance, offering moderately complex layouts that
require a solid understanding of both analog and early digital automotive systems. This
middle ground means that technicians familiar with general automotive electrical
principles can reasonably adapt to C4 Corvette wiring diagrams without specialized
training that later generations might demand.
